Chemical composition in sealants

NIR can be used to analyze the chemical composition of sealants. This involves identifying and quantifying various components, such as polymers, fillers, solvents and other additives.

Moisture content in sealants

The moisture content in sealants can influence adhesion and curing. NIR can be used to measure and control moisture content.

Viscosity of sealants

NIR can provide indirect information about the viscosity of sealants through correlations with chemical composition and other properties. However, accurate viscosity measurements may require specialized viscometers.

Curing condition of sealants

For sealants that are curing, NIR can be used to monitor the degree of curing. This is important for controlling production quality and ensuring the desired properties of the final sealant compound.

Temperature control in the production of sealants with NIR

NIR can be used in combination with temperature sensors to monitor the temperature of the kit. This is important because the curing of some sealants can depend on the ambient temperature.

Molecular structure of sealants

NIR can provide information about the molecular structure of polymers and other components in sealants. This insight can be helpful in understanding the sealant's properties and performance.

Quality of raw materials for sealants

NIR can be used to monitor the quality of raw materials in sealants, including detecting impurities or variations in composition.

Density and volume change of sealants

NIR can be used to measure the density and volume change of sealants, which can be important for applications where the precision of the final product is crucial.

Color measurement of sealants

For colored sealants, NIR can be used for color measurement and color control. This helps maintain consistent color quality in the sealants produced.

Many benefits of using NIR in sealant production

The use of NIR in sealant production offers benefits such as rapid analysis, non-destructive measurements and real-time process control capabilities. However, it is important to calibrate and adapt the NIR system to the specific characteristics of the sealants used and the production environment.
